In article number 2001267, Wing‐Fu Lai and co‐workers develop a bioinspired and luminescent material which can respond to internal signals to enable biphasic monitoring of the drug delivery process. Together with its ease of fabrication, high biocompatibility, high drug loading efficiency, and high release sustainability, this material shows high potential to be developed into an intelligent solid‐state device for wound treatment in the future.
